Historical Roots of St. Anthony St. Antonius Polish

Devotion to St. Anthony in Polish contexts grew through immigration to the United States in the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. Polish parishes cultivated a unique expression of this devotion, integrating folk traditions, hymns, and the prominent role of family and neighborhood associations.

Prayer Practices and Novena Structure

Central to St. Anthony St. Antonius Polish practice is the structured nine-day novena, often prayed before the feast day closest to 13 June. These novenas combine specific invocations, the Chaplet of St. Anthony, and communal petitions for lost items or personal intentions.

Parish Life and Community Traditions

Polish-American parishes organize processions, school competitions to memorize prayers, and community meals that highlight pierogi and other traditional dishes. These events strengthen bonds and pass the devotional practices to younger members.

Role of Choirs and Music

Hymns composed in Polish, accompanied by organ or band, feature prominently during Sunday Masses and special feast day services. Choir directors often collaborate with religious education coordinators to teach children the melodies and meanings behind the texts.

Modern Relevance and Outreach

Today, St. Anthony St. Antonius Polish devotion continues through online prayer groups, parish apps, and hybrid services that connect diaspora communities. These efforts help preserve cultural identity while expanding access to spiritual support for busy families.
